Traditional Side Dish for Paneer Paratha
A traditional side dish for paneer paratha, mint-coriander chutney is a zesty and refreshing accompaniment. Made with fresh mint leaves, coriander, green chilies, and a hint of lemon, this chutney adds a tangy and spicy kick to the rich and creamy paneer paratha.
Raita, a yogurt-based side dish, is another classic pairing with paneer paratha. Whether it's a simple cucumber raita or a more elaborate boondi raita, the cooling effect of yogurt complements the spiciness of the paratha perfectly, balancing the flavors.
Innovative Side Dish for Paneer Paratha
For a modern twist, try pairing your paneer paratha with an avocado dip. This creamy and nutritious side dish adds a smooth texture and a mild flavor that complements the spiciness of the paratha. Simply mash ripe avocados with lemon juice, salt, and a touch of garlic for a delightful dip.
A fresh and tangy tomato-basil salsa can be an excellent side dish for paneer paratha. The combination of ripe tomatoes, fresh basil, onions, and a dash of lime juice provides a burst of flavor and a refreshing contrast to the rich paneer filling.
Spicy Side Dish for Paneer Paratha
If you enjoy a bit of heat, a spicy mango pickle can be the perfect side dish for paneer paratha. The tangy and fiery flavors of the pickle enhance the taste of the paratha, adding an exciting dimension to your meal.
A chili-garlic chutney is another spicy accompaniment that pairs wonderfully with paneer paratha. Made with roasted garlic, red chilies, and a touch of vinegar, this chutney adds a bold and robust flavor to the paratha.
Sweet Side Dish for Paneer Paratha
For those who prefer a touch of sweetness, a sweet mango chutney can be an excellent side dish for paneer paratha. The sweetness of ripe mangoes combined with spices and a hint of tanginess creates a delicious contrast to the savory paratha.
A pineapple raita is a unique and refreshing side dish for paneer paratha. The sweetness of pineapple chunks mixed with creamy yogurt and a hint of cumin adds a delightful flavor and texture to the meal.

Healthy Side Dish for Paneer Paratha
Cucumber Salad A simple cucumber salad, made with sliced cucumbers, onions, tomatoes, and a sprinkle of chaat masala, can be a refreshing and healthy side dish for paneer paratha. It adds a crunchy texture and a fresh flavor to your meal.
Sprouts Salad A sprouts salad, mixed with chopped vegetables and a dash of lemon juice, is a nutritious and wholesome side dish that complements the rich paneer paratha perfectly. It adds a healthy crunch and is packed with vitamins and minerals.
Indian Curry as a Side Dish for Paneer Paratha
Dal Makhani Dal makhani, a creamy and flavorful lentil curry, is an excellent side dish for paneer paratha. The richness of the dal complements the paneer, creating a hearty and satisfying meal.
Chole (Chickpea Curry) Chole, a spicy chickpea curry, pairs wonderfully with paneer paratha. The robust flavors of the chickpea curry enhance the taste of the paratha, making for a fulfilling and delicious combination.
